I have been playing this deck for a while now and recently took it to 2 tournys getting 2 second places.Both losses came down to one game and in one I was sitting there staring at one wasteland as my only land.The other was vs prison and i was a little mana hosed but prison is a very tough match for this deck and to be honest even on a great draw I would have had problems.Here is the deck

3 bottle gnomes
4 taals
4 black knights
4 bonedancers
2 necrosavant
1 Brother Very Grimm(morifin)
1 Other Brother Very Grimm(gallowbraid)
4 stupors
4 edicts
3 dark rituals
4 drain life
3 disk
17 swamp
4 quicksand
3 wasteland

SB:this changes a bit but basically..
3 gloom
1 dread of night
4 coercion
1 disk
3 spinning darkness
1 envicars justice
2 perish(may switch to touchstones as green doesnt hurt much and orb really screws me)

There it is..the Brothers Very Grimm.It may seem simple and but it has done very well vs many decks.Yeah I know what all the loudmouths are thinking'
"dude..you have no enchantment removal cept disks"
"you will lose to p-bloom and combo decks"
"light of day will stop you cold"

blah blah blah.Sure this deck can lose.ANY...repeat...ANY deck can lose if you play a deck that happens to be a very good match up for your deck.Necro is one of the oldest and most feared decks around..but a simple sligh deck can turn it off if they aernt careful.Heres are some good points about this deck.Tons of critter kill,and more in SB.t2 is fairly critter heavy lately although this is declining thanks to the Steely Golum which seems to be popping up in every deck.The disks are key...the old black reset button.Bonedancers work GREAT with all the removal if they can get through even once.Now the black fat.They do well for one simple reason..no one expects them and they,like the bonedancers,are a MUST deal with card.Everyone is caught up on weenies and mana effiecient critters.Thing is,I can ignore a soltari priest for a little while,unless its wearing a Maro Armor..but how long can you ignore a Gallowbraid?Or a Savant?I know they can be pacified etc.but isnt that the point?To have critters so dangerous that opp MUST deal with them?Plus all the life gain helps to feed the upkeep of the Brothers Very Grimm.For blue decks,,extremely powerful BTW..I side in the 4 coercions and disk giving me 8 discard spells and 4 disks for the diamonds,props,etc.I just try to hit them with discard as often as i can to burn counters.If they get an orb on the board OK I will most likely lose..But blue is slow and the rituals help a lot.And a bonedancered Air Elemental is always a sight to behold.Light of day is awful if it gets through but I side in 3 glooms the 4th disk 4 coercions and pray.Plus i still have my drains..
